Strategy/Organization/Ideas / Campaign messages
« on: June 13, 2016, 02:30:11 AM »
Whether or not people are ready for actual dissolution of the federal government, I believe this message/platform needs to be heard and considered by everyone (even if they laugh at first).  National elections are (unfortunately) one of the few contexts in which people consider their political views in a slightly more critical way, so it also makes sense to communicate this platform as a candidate.

But I think people will not be ready to seriously consider this platform until they can see a somewhat continuous path into a post-USA world, where many steps are already being taken outside of the federal government to make it irrelevant and obsolete, to take over at least some of its functions.  And some voluntarist institutions could be preparing for the day to take over certain functions, even if they cannot perform them while the federal government still exists.

I think the campaign and platform should emphasize strategies for dissolving government from the outside in this manner as we prepare for the day when we can have a critical mass of people ready to instigate a dissolution from the inside (supposing the federal government lasts that long, which I think is likely since it is such a juggernaut).

And I think one of the best ways to show people this can work is to do it at smaller levels of government -- the smallest levels, in fact.  Even starting within our personal lives, by taking responsibility for things that governments (or other illegitimate authorities in our lives) would otherwise handle for us.

If we are truly successful in spreading this message, the dissolution may be more likely to initiate from the ground up, with lower-level governments dissolving by their uselessness / counter-productiveness / coercion becoming more evident, and then the higher-level governments no longer having the lower-level governments to operate as intermediaries.  As institutions are developed to truly protect people from coercion and fraud at a more local level, they may become trusted and powerful enough to start protecting people from the more distant criminals (politicians).  Then people will be ready to dissolve the federal government.

Strategy/Organization/Ideas / Transparty coalition
« on: June 13, 2016, 01:40:58 AM »
Idea: Multiple people run on this same platform in as many parties as possible, perhaps all in a "Voluntarist coalition".

Each person should have an affinity and sympathy with their chosen party, and would try to use the language and priorities of their chosen party's base to communicate the ideas of freedom and respect in a way they can more easily relate to.  Essentially, in the language of Marshall Rosenberg's "nonviolent communication", each would focus mainly on the fundamental human needs that stand out most strongly in each party (as well as focusing on the party's favorite issues).  These people could also do events together, trying to show the common ground between the parties.
